Machines \(K, M,\) and \(N,\) each working alone at its constant rate, produce \(1\) widget in \(x, y,\) and \(2\) minutes, respectively. If Machines \(K, M,\) and \(N\) work simultaneously at their respective constant rates, does it take them less than \(1\) hour to produce a total of \(50\) widgets?

(1) \(x < 1.5\)
(2) \(y < 1.2\)

Answer: D
